Overview

Product introduction and key characteristics

Crown Plastic Pipes / Fittings manufactures LLDPE drip tubing to ASAE S435 standards for precision agricultural irrigation across the UAE and GCC. Available in ½″ to 1″ sizes with working pressures up to 4.8 bar, these pipes are engineered for drip irrigation systems in the UAE. Produced at our Umm Al Quwain facility with ISO 9001:2015 certification.

Pipe Specifications

Technical dimensions and parameters for all pipe sizes

ASAE S435

Ordering CodeNominal Inside Diameter (in)Nominal Inside Diameter (mm)Minimum Inside Diameter (in)Minimum Inside Diameter (mm)Minimum Wall Thickness (m.m)Nominal Working Pressure (Psi)Nominal Working Pressure (Bar)
CPDP 15670D (112)½130.61715.671.12694.8
CPDP 15670D (124)½150.70717.961.24674.6
CPDP 18110D (107)½160.71318.111.07573.9
CPDP 20900D (119)¾180.82320.901.19553.8
CPDP 23440D (132)¾210.92323.441.32603.7
CPDP 30020D (157)1271.18030.021.57503.4

Installation Guidelines

Best practices for optimal performance and longevity

Do's

  • Ensure butt-fusion welding is performed using correct temperatures for the specific PE grade.
  • Verify the SDR and PN ratings match the intended application's hydrostatic design stress.
  • Use pipes with sufficient carbon black content for long-term outdoor UV exposure.
  • Follow the MRS guidelines to ensure the pipe meets its 50-year design life at 20°C.

Don'ts

  • Do not use non-potable pipes for drinking water distribution.
  • Avoid exceeding the maximum allowable hydrostatic design stress specified for the material.
  • Do not install pipes that have deep scratches or physical damage exceeding standard tolerances.
  • Avoid using materials that do not conform to the required design coefficient 'C' for pressure safety.
